Founded in 2010, Saatva focuses on direct-to-consumer luxury bed mattress under three trademark name: Saatva, Loom & Leaf, and Zenhaven. In between these 3 brand names, the company sells numerous bed mattress designs, including the all-foam Loom & Leaf;& Leaf; the latex Zenhaven; the airbed, Solaire; and the hybrid Saatva. Ideal for: Individuals with more specific firmness choices Sleepers of any size and sleep position Those who tend to sleep hot Couples trying to find a combination of pressure relief and bounce Many online bed mattress are foams or hybrids, so the Saatva Classic stands apart. It is among the few innerspring mattresses you can easily buy online. Pocketed coils provide the Saatva Classic a great quantity of bounce near the top, and a plush top includes softness. As with all of the Saatva Company’s mattresses, the Saatva Classic is provided by movers, rather than in a box. Saatva also uses a generous 180-day trial period and easy returns.

The Saatva’s convenience system uses thinner layers of foam than lots of hybrid models. These thinner layers of foam combined with the Euro-top’s fiber fill soak up some motion, lowering how much motion is felt across the surface of the bed. Sleepers might still experience some movement transfer when their partner modifications position or gets up during the night due to the mattress’s two layers of springs.Thanks to its softer feel, the Plush Soft variation of the Saatva takes in somewhat more motion than the Luxury Firm and Firm choices.While all of the Saatva firmness choices have pressure-relieving potential, the quantity of pressure relief that a private experiences on the bed mattress will differ based partially on their weight and sleep position. People who weigh under 130 pounds will likely experience the most press relief on the Plush Soft variation of the mattress, while sleepers over 230 pounds will likely get the best balance of contouring and assistance from the Firm version. 

Note: Saatva recently updated the Zenhaven, altering the kind of latex utilized in its foam layers. The Zenhaven now features Dunlop latex, instead of Talalay latex; find out more about the distinctions below. We plan to test the brand-new version soon and will upgrade this guide with our impressions.

 

The Zenhaven is likewise flippable (the High-end Plush side feels medium-firm, while the Mild Company side feels a bit firmer), which may show useful if you’re not sure what you prefer or if your requirements change over time. This is not a traditionally soft bed mattress, however it uses a supple cushion, great edge support, and a subtle springiness.

Making sense of Saatva Saatva’s portfolio of beds– many with a choice of firmness levels and accommodating nearly every convenience choice– includes: Saatva Classic ( innerspring).
Loom & Leaf ( all foam).
Zenhaven ( all latex).
Saatva Latex Hybrid ( latex with coils).

Saatva HD ( a latex-coil hybrid created for sleepers who weigh 300 to 500 pounds).
Saatva Youth ( a foam-coil hybrid for kids ages 3 through 12).

 

We have not yet done a deep dive into the “natural” claims of Saatva or of other “environment-friendly” brand names. However we do know that the company uses thistle pulp or natural wool as a flame retardant (rather than fiberglass or chemicals) and only organic cotton (instead of artificial blends) in its covers. As do other online bed mattress companies, Saatva promotes such bonus as zoned layers for “optimal spine support”; we’re less pleased with those features and more appreciative of Saatva’s responsive client service and resilient foams and coils.
